I think that when he finally closed the book on Clement and figured out just how deep the corruption was in the DPD, he really was done. I think he came to understand that he couldn't keep doing what he was doing how he was used to doing it and be a great father to Willa. I genuinely believe his intent was to avoid the kind of dynamic that he had with Arlo. So when he's out on the boat and he gets the call that Boyd broke out...I think he lets it ring. The totality of all that he has done is to be considered here and that's why I believe this retirement is final. He can't risk another go with Boyd and chance things going his way again. It's someone else's problem now, not his.

I think the main reason Raylan quit was because he killed a man for the first time and it wasn't completely justified. The question Raylan asked himself was did he kill Mansell because he had to or because he wanted to. And in the end the answer is he wanted to. Raylan always took pride in being better than his father and he realized that he can be just as bad as him. That combined with his age made him walk away from the job that defined who he is.

I think you might be confusing "charming" with "decent". Clement killed, screwed over, provoked, threatened, and steamrolled over every person he encountered. He was the kind of man who, upon seeing a hornets nest, would kick it just to see what happens. He has never given any of his actions a second thought, and is only ever concerned with himself. He killed over a dozen people before he broke into his lawyer's house, the night after he shot his best friend and burned down his bar. And in the end, he was more concerned with Raylan's opinion of his singing voice than the consequences of his actions.
